How Plainclothes Police: Can They Get Away with Anything? Actually Works
At its core, plainclothes policing involves officers conducting duties without wearing a traditional uniform, allowing them to blend into the environment. This approach is typically used for specific investigative purposes, such as gathering intelligence, monitoring situations where overt presence might alter behavior, or conducting controlled operations under strict protocols. Legal guidelines, department policies, and supervisory oversight all shape how these operations are authorized and executed. Plainclothes Police: Can They Get Away with Anything? is best understood by examining the layers of regulation that govern such activities, including warrants, probable cause requirements, and rules about use of force that apply equally regardless of an officer's appearance.
In practice, plainclothes officers are not given a "free pass" to act without accountability. Their actions are subject to the same constitutional protections and legal standards as uniformed officers, and any use of authority must be justified under law. Body cameras, incident reports, internal reviews, and civilian oversight mechanisms often apply to plainclothes operations, reinforcing transparency. For example, an officer working in plain clothes during a narcotics investigation must still adhere to rules about searches, seizures, and communication with supervisors. By understanding that plainclothes work is a tool rather than a loophole, the public can better appreciate how these operations fit into the broader system of justice and public safety.

How can I identify plainclothes police if they are not wearing a uniform?
Identification remains a top concern for civilians who encounter someone claiming police authority without a traditional uniform. In most jurisdictions, plainclothes officers are required to carry visible credentials, such as a badge, ID card, or wallet-sized identification upon request. They may also drive marked vehicles or wear recognizable equipment, like a jacket or vest with police insignia, even if their outer clothing is casual. If you are unsure, you have the right to ask for identification and, if safe to do so, request to confirm their identity over the phone or by contacting the agency directly. This approach protects both public safety and lawful police work.
What legal safeguards exist to prevent abuse in plainclothes operations?
Plainclothes operations are typically subject to heightened internal review and external oversight. Many departments require supervisors to approve such assignments, document the rationale, and ensure that officers understand the rules for use of force, detention procedures, and reporting obligations. Courts also rely on established standards, such as probable cause and reasonableness, to evaluate whether an officer's conduct was lawful. When incidents involving Plainclothes Police: Can They Get Away with Anything? arise, investigations examine whether protocols were followed, evidence was obtained legally, and constitutional rights were respected. These layers of oversight aim to prevent misconduct while allowing legitimate investigative techniques to continue serving public safety goals.

Can plainclothes officers conduct traffic stops or enter private property without announcing their status?
Traffic stops and property entries by plainclothes officers generally follow specific legal rules, often requiring clear communication of authority to ensure citizen cooperation and safety. In many cases, officers may rely on marked vehicles or visible indicators once it is practical to do so, particularly during high-risk situations. When immediate action is necessary, courts typically examine whether the officer acted reasonably under the circumstances. Opportunities and Considerations
Exploring Plainclothes Police: Can They Get Away with Anything? reveals both practical benefits and important limitations of this policing method. On the positive side, plainclothes operations can provide valuable intelligence, reduce tensions in sensitive investigations, and allow officers to observe behavior in natural settings. These advantages are particularly relevant in cases involving organized crime, human trafficking, or complex fraud schemes where visibility might compromise an investigation. However, potential drawbacks include the risk of misidentification, public discomfort, and challenges in maintaining transparency. Balancing these factors requires strong training, clear policies, and ongoing dialogue between law enforcement and the communities they serve, ensuring that each operation meets legal, ethical, and operational standards.
Things People Often Misunderstand
A common misconception is that plainclothes officers operate with fewer rules or greater impunity than uniformed counterparts. In reality, legal standards and department policies do not change based on attire; officers remain accountable for their actions under the same laws governing all policing. Another misunderstanding involves the belief that plainclothes work is primarily used for minor offenses, when in fact these operations are typically reserved for serious investigations with strict authorization.
